Comprehending Types of Car Keys

Before diving into the replacement procedure, it’s crucial to comprehend the types of car keys you’ll come across. These can differ considerably based upon the make and design of your vehicle. Here are some common types:

Type of Key Description
Conventional Metal Key A standard key without any electronic parts.
Transponder Key A key with a chip that interacts with the vehicle’s ignition repair service system.
Smart Key A keyless ignition system with electronic fob functionalities.
Key Fob A push-button control that locks/unlocks doors and can begin the vehicle.

Comprehending these kinds of keys is vital as it directly affects the replacement expense, process, and technology required.

The Replacement Process

The process for changing a car key can appear daunting, but it can typically be broken down into several workable steps:

  1. Identifying Key Type: Determine the type of key you need to replace. This will affect your next actions.

  2. Calling a Locksmith or Dealership: Depending on the kind of key, you can select to contact a locksmith or your vehicle’s dealership. Lock Smiths are often more affordable, particularly for traditional keys. Car dealerships may be needed for transponder or wise keys.

  3. Proof of Ownership: You will normally require to supply evidence of ownership of the vehicle. This may include:

    • Vehicle registration document
    • A valid motorist’s license
    • Any previous car keys, if available
  4. Key Cutting and Programming: Once you’ve confirmed your ownership, the locksmith or car dealership will cut a new key and program any electronic elements as required.

  5. Evaluating the Key: Before leaving the facilities, make sure that the new key works properly with your vehicle.

Relative Pricing

The cost of car key replacement can differ extensively based on several aspects: the kind of key, whether it’s a dealership or locksmith service, and included features like remote gain access to. Here’s a breakdown based on key types:

Key Type Expected Cost Notes
Standard Metal Key ₤ 5 – ₤ 30 Least expensive choice, commonly offered.
Transponder Key ₤ 50 – ₤ 150 More specialized, needs programming.
Smart Key ₤ 150 – ₤ 250 Complex, often needs the dealer.
Key Fob ₤ 50 – ₤ 200 Can differ, dependent on battery and features.

Constantly get multiple quotes to guarantee you protect the best offer.

Frequently Asked Questions About Car Key Replacement

1. What should I do if I lose my car keys?

  • Browse thoroughly in common locations. If they stay missing, get in touch with a locksmith or car dealership for a replacement.

2. Can I change my car key myself?

  • While you can cut standard keys at some hardware shops, transponder and wise keys require appropriate programming that typically requires expert equipment.

3. The length of time does it require to change a car key?

  • Typically, it can take anywhere from 20 minutes to over an hour, depending upon the complexity of the key.

4. Will my car be damaged during the replacement procedure?

  • No, a professional locksmith or car dealership will replace your key without damaging your vehicle.

5. Are there any preventative procedures to avoid losing keys?

  • Utilizing a key finder gadget or a designated spot for keys in the house can assist. Furthermore, consider a spare key for emergency situations.
